HISTORY:

The idea for a gallery to honor Birger Sandzén was initially launched in 1955 with the incorporation of the Birger Sandzén Memorial Foundation. The gallery originally contained ten exhibition areas which include two corridors, two large rooms, four smaller rooms, a sculpture hall and a library and opened to the public in 1957. The first exhibition was a retrospective of art by Birger Sandzén from 1910 to 1952.

The Sandzén Gallery exhibits artwork by its namesake, Birger Sandzén throughout the year. Works from its permanent collection, historic and loaned exhibitions, as well as active contemporary artists are also displayed.

Special programs, chamber music concerts, poetry readings, gallery talks and special member events are also a part of the yearly calendar.

The Gallery also actively loans paintings, prints, drawings and sculpture from the permanent collection for exhibitions in galleries and museums nationwide.
